This is the six-wheel Tyrrell, as driven by Jody Scheckter, at the 1976 Canadian Grand Prix at Mosport, Ontario. I took the photo from the timing tower, where I was on timing and scoring duty as a member of the Canadian Timing Association (all volunteers). The fuzzy post in the foreground is part of the set up for a primitive computer timing system, but we were still using hand held timers back then. When I started, it was stop watches with split hands
